Perhaps we should also try to get some more centralized exchanges, though I agree time may be passing them by. But for now they are still useful. During the 2021 bull market, many of the most spectacular small cap runs happened on smart contract based markets. Centralized exchanges listed them _after_ their success on decentralized markets. These markets have the advantage of incentivized participation from new generation of small cap traders (who are very different in nature from 2017, but also larger in number). Monero is already integrated to secretswap, which has inferior privacy compared to atomic swaps, but it opens to an entirely new user base and liquidity structure. The integration with thorswap afaik is still ongoing, but that opens the possibility to trade Monero directly against native tokens of other chains (btc, eth, doge, ltc, bnb, luna, and some others). Privacy is worse in both cases, compared to atomic swaps, but at this point lack of liquidity is a more pressing issue. There is going to be a privacy themed bull run, and it will likely happen on a newer generation, more decentralized cross-chain platform. Aeon is so cheap right now, that even the promise of future integration there could spark some interest and activism - as it did for other projects.

Maybe we could offer a bounty structure for community members to recruit exchanges? [/quote] Yea do you remember www.aeonfunding.com run by Cam? How well did that work for proposals to fund listing fees for exchanges in 2017/2018/2019? I even had exchanges like atomicdex (one of the first large-scale dex) that nobody wanted to fund, back when Aeon was 10x and 50x its current price. There is little to no community left for this and the leg work will have to be done by you and or stoffu, or designate a specific person who is considered a dev team member for marketing and exchange contacts (will need KYC 100% to do this with legit exchanges) RE: atomicswaps Did you ever see how many Aeon users actually used BisQ? 3 people. Nobody wants to actually use this. It's a great concept but worthless for anything more than PR stunts. Want to pump the coin price? Market Atomicswaps integrated. Want to add actual value to the project? Get listed on some larger DEX and centralized exchanges or finish ledger/trezor support. If you want to get on larger exchanges, you will need a minimum of $100k each unless you have inside access like Bittrex. Kraken, Poloneix, Coinbase, Binance, Huboi. Just trying to help here because you know, been there done that.
